Android ile dosyadan veri okuma ve yazma islemi

android
  • Turgay Can
  • Tarih

    13 Dec, 2012
  • Yorum

    0
  • Görüntüleme

    3610
  • İndirme

    0

Android ile dosyadan veri okuma ve yazma islemi

Android ile doayadan veri okuma işlemi java ile neredeyse birebir aynıdır sadece Android'in yapısı itibari ile AssetManager nesnesi üzerinden dosyanın adresi verilir geri kalan kısım standart InputStream nesnesi ile veri okumak ile aynıdır. ByteArrayOutputStream nesnesi ile yazma işlemini yapacağım.

Örnek bir implementasyon kodu aşağıdaki gibidir. Umarım işinize yarar.

AssetManager am = context.getAssets();
InputStream is = am.open("test.txt");
System.out.println(inputStream);      
ByteArrayOutputStream byteArrayOutputStream = new ByteArrayOutputStream();  
int i;   
try {  
 i = inputStream.read();
    while (i != -1)       {     
   byteArrayOutputStream.write(i);   
     i = inputStream.read();   
    }
       inputStream.close(); 
  } catch (IOException e) {  
  // TODO Auto-generated catch block  
  e.printStackTrace();   
}

0 Yorum..

Yorum yapmak için "Giriş yapın" yada "Misafir üye" olarak yorum yapabilirsiniz.

Yorum Yap